Electrochemical oxidative dehydrodimerization of naphthylamines. An efficient synthesis of 8,8-dianilino-5,5'-binaphthalene-1,1'-disulfonate

Abstract: mA (current density: 1.6 A/dm2). After 8.0 F/mol of electricity was passed, the reaction mixture was poured into 100 mL of a saturated sodium chloride solution and extracted with three 50-mL portions of ether. The combined ethereal solution was dried over anhydrous magnesium sulfate, filtered, and concentrated to give an oily material, which was then fractionally distilled to form almost pure 2-methyl-4-methoxyphenol (8) in 42% yield; mp 71-72 °C [lit.28 mp 71-72 °C].
